First, let’s talk about what makes bath bomb slime so special. Bath bombs are typically made of a combination of baking soda, citric acid, Epsom salt, and essential oils, and when they are dropped into water, they fizz and release a pleasant aroma. Slime, on the other hand, is a squishy and stretchy substance made of glue, liquid starch, and other ingredients. When you combine the two, you get a unique sensory experience that is both satisfying and relaxing.

To make your own bath bomb slime, you will need the following ingredients:

– 1 cup of baking soda
– 1/2 cup of citric acid
– 1/4 cup of Epsom salt
– 1/4 cup of cornstarch
– 2 tablespoons of coconut oil
– Food coloring of your choice
– Essential oils (optional)
– Glue
– Liquid starch

Start by mixing the baking soda, citric acid, Epsom salt, and cornstarch in a bowl. In a separate container, mix the coconut oil, food coloring, and essential oils. Slowly p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ients, stirring constantly until you have a thick paste. Add more coconut oil if the mixture is too dry, or more cornstarch if it is too wet.

Next, make the slime by mixing equal parts of glue and liquid starch in a separate bowl. Stir well until the mixture comes together and forms a stretchy slime. You can adjust the consistency by adding more glue or liquid starch as needed.

Now comes the fun part – combining the bath bomb mixture with the slime! Slowly fold the slime into the bath bomb mixture, being careful not to overmix. You want to achieve a marbled effect with the two textures still visible. Once you are happy with the consistency, you can start playing with your bath bomb slime!

One important thing to keep in mind when making bath bomb slime is to store it properly. Since it contains ingredients that can spoil or dry out, it is important to keep it in an airtight container when not in use. You can also add a few drops of water if the slime becomes too dry, or more cornstarch if it becomes too sticky.
